| def nao_footstep_clipping::clip_footstep | ( | foot, | ||
| is_left_support | ||||
| ) | 
Clipping functions to avoid any warnings and undesired effects
    when sending the footsteps to ALMotion.
    foot is an almath.Pose2D (x, y, theta position)
    is_left_support must be set to True if the move is on the right leg
    (the robot is supporting itself on the left leg).

| def nao_footstep_clipping::clip_footstep_on_gait_config | ( | foot, | ||
| is_left_support | ||||
| ) | 
Clip the foot move so that it does not exceed the maximum
    size of steps.
    foot is an almath.Pose2D (x, y, theta position).
    is_left_support must be set to True if the move is on the right leg
    (the robot is supporting itself on the left leg).

| def nao_footstep_clipping::clip_footstep_to_avoid_collision | ( | foot, | ||
| is_left_support | ||||
| ) | 
Clip the foot move to avoid collision with the other foot.
    foot is an almath.Pose2D (x, y, theta position).
    is_left_support must be set to True if the move is on the right leg
    (the robot is supporting itself on the left leg).
